WebJul 15, 2014 · The tensile strength of LWAC was about 0.8–0.85 of that of Normal Weight Concrete (NWC) of equal strength, decreasing to about 0.7 in LWAC with lightweight sand. Contrary to compressive strength, the LWAC with less porous aggregates has lower tensile structural efficiency than NWC. WebDec 15, 2024 · The uniaxial compressive, flexural strength, and drying shrinkage of the developed lightweight aggregate concrete (LWAC) specimens have been determined along with thermal conductivity. The results revealed that compressive and flexural strength of the developed LWAC blocks was in the range of 16.7–23.9 MPa and 2.8–3.4 MPa, respectively.
